Output ed437874f8bdba0b0becf83bdfb1aace90af099423fed5ca1b13c836c3fea2a1:5

value
26414384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b851d1a0ea9573c5d597154e988b8d57b3749920 OP_EQUAL
address
MQhkabpY6a5eACG8iG3rXRZ9F6fdWpjerv
transaction
ed437874f8bdba0b0becf83bdfb1aace90af099423fed5ca1b13c836c3fea2a1
spent
true